2014-06-15 3 views
0

저는 Ubuntu 14.04에 있고 Android Studio 버전 0.5.2를 사용하고 있습니다. 내 안드로이드 스튜디오 GCM SAMPLEAndroid Studio 지원되지 않는 버전의 gradle이지만 호환되는 버전을 사용하고 있습니다.

에이 프로젝트를 가져 오기 위해 노력하고있어하지만 난이 오류를 얻을 : enter image description here

그것은 내가 Gradle을 버전 1.10를 사용해야 있다고합니다.

그러나 나는 그 버전을 실제로 사용하고 있습니다. enter image description here

여기 무슨 일입니까?

답변

2

잘못된 오류 메시지가 나타납니다. 실제 문제는 프로젝트에서 Android Gradle 플러그인의 잘못된 버전을 사용하고 있다는 것입니다.이 프로젝트에서는 0.7을 지정하지만 Android Studio 0.5.2에서는 0.9가 필요합니다. 이 블록에서

프로젝트의 최상위에서

에게 build.gradle :

buildscript { 
    repositories { 
     mavenCentral() 
    } 
    dependencies { 
     classpath 'com.android.tools.build:gradle:0.7.+' 
    } 
} 

변경 classpath 라인은 :

 classpath 'com.android.tools.build:gradle:0.9.+' 
+0

프로젝트의 build.gradle 에는 buildscript 블록 없다 난 그냥 종속성 블록에있는 다른 항목과 함께 배치하려했습니다. 이렇게 : 종속성 { 'com.google.android.gms : play-services : 4.0.30' 'com.android.support:appcompat-v7:+' 'com.android.support:support- v4 : 19.0.0 ' 컴파일'de.greenrobot : eventbus : 2.2.0 ' 'de.keyboardsurfer.android.widget : crouton : 1.8.2 ' classpath'com.android.tools.build:gradle:0.9를 컴파일하십시오. . + ' } 하지만 여전히 같은 오류가 발생합니다. –

+0

이 파일은 다음과 같습니다. https://github.com/writtmeyer/gcm_sample/blob/master/build.gradle –

+0

아, 최고 수준입니다. 죄송합니다. 이제 시도해 보겠습니다. –

관련 문제